It sounds strange today, but one of the most natural east‑west rail corridors in Europe – between Berlin (Germany) and Szczecin (Poland) – once had fast, through services that simply do not exist anymore in anything like their former form. During the twentieth century, this axis was a strategic rail artery, especially when Szczecin (then Stettin) was tightly integrated into the German network. After borders shifted following the Second World War and political priorities changed during the Cold War, much of that seamless connectivity frayed and never truly recovered.

There are still trains between the two cities, but what vanished are the high‑priority, long‑distance routes that treated this as a major international hinge rather than a slightly awkward border branch. Where there were once dense timetables and prestige services, there are now slower, more regional lines, with gaps, changes of trains, and lower capacity. The path itself exists on the ground, but its old role as a primary east‑west corridor was effectively retired without being structurally replaced by an equally direct and ambitious route.

Transport planners sometimes talk about the “ghost” of this corridor when they draw up new European TEN‑T network maps. The demand for a strong Berlin–Baltic connection never fully went away; it just got pushed sideways onto longer, more circuitous routes. In practical terms, that means journeys that ought to be a straight horizontal line often zigzag instead through hubs that were never designed to handle so much connecting traffic.

Before transatlantic jets became routine, flying boats were the glamorous, improbable way to cross the ocean. Pan American World Airways built a network of “Clipper” routes in the 1930s and 1940s that hopped between sheltered bays and lagoons – places like Botwood in Newfoundland, Foynes in Ireland, and island harbors in the Azores. These locations were chosen because they had calm water and enough space for large seaplanes to land and take off, long before there were long concrete runways everywhere.

When pressurized landplanes like the Boeing 707 and Douglas DC‑8 arrived, the logic of the entire system flipped. Instead of needing water, airlines now needed long, paved runways and modern terminals. The flying‑boat bases, often in remote or geographically awkward spots, had no compelling reason to remain major hubs. As jet travel took over in the 1950s and 1960s, the once‑prestigious seaplane routes were shut down outright. In many cases, no equivalent scheduled commercial route was created from the exact same origin to the exact same watery destination.

Modern North Atlantic flights connect large land airports – New York to London, Boston to Dublin, Toronto to Paris. Botwood’s harbor, for instance, no longer plays any role in mainstream civil aviation. There is no “replacement” for a route like New York–Botwood–Foynes by seaplane; the entire premise vanished. What survives is more of a memory than an infrastructure: museum exhibits, rusting hangars, and the occasional flying‑boat festival reminding people that, for a short, strange era, the most advanced transatlantic corridor did not touch land at all.

The Baikal–Amur region in Siberia is usually associated with the Baikal–Amur Mainline, a parallel cousin to the Trans‑Siberian Railway. But for decades, especially in the most intense construction phases, the real lifeline was not the finished track; it was the network of temporary work convoys, ice roads, and ad‑hoc winter routes used to bring people and materials into some of the most remote terrain on the planet. These were not commuter routes in the everyday sense, yet they were incredibly regular and structured, functioning season after season like a hidden highway system.

Once construction on major segments of the Baikal–Amur Mainline wound down and permanent rail infrastructure became operational, those seasonal supply routes lost their primary purpose. Many of the convoys stopped running; ice roads that were painstakingly carved into the permafrost each winter simply were not rebuilt. Because the official goal was always to replace them with conventional rail logistics, no one considered them worth preserving or upgrading for civilian mobility afterward.

The irony is that local communities along the old work corridors sometimes lost options when the temporary infrastructure disappeared. What had been a rough but direct winter road, or a regular work train that allowed locals to hitch rides, turned into an impassable stretch of forest once the project ended. The new mainline, meanwhile, often sat tens or hundreds of kilometers away, threading a more “rational” route optimized for long‑haul freight, not everyday regional connectivity.

Yangon, Myanmar’s largest city, has a famous circular railway that still operates, creaking along and serving commuters and vendors. Less remembered are some of the short branch lines and spurs that once connected peripheral industrial zones and docks more directly into the circle. Over time, civil conflict, underinvestment, shifting economic priorities, and damage from weather and neglect took their toll. Some of these minor routes went from active to sporadic to completely silent.

On paper, “replacement” bus services or road corridors stepped in. On the ground, though, what vanished was the simple, predictable feeling of being able to step onto a train and know it would run, even slowly, in nearly any weather. The dying branches became overgrown, their tracks buckling in the tropical heat. In a few cases, they were physically ripped up for scrap during periods of intense economic stress, which effectively locked in their disappearance.

High in the eastern Himalayas, access to Darjeeling was once dominated by the Hill Cart Road, an engineered route that wound its way up terrifying slopes. Before modern highways and widespread car ownership, this road – and later, the narrow‑gauge Darjeeling Himalayan Railway that paralleled parts of it – was an essential colonial artery. Traders, officials, and local residents all depended on it to move tea, supplies, and people between the lowlands and the hill stations.

Over the twentieth century, repeated landslides, monsoon damage, and changing engineering standards led to sections of the old Hill Cart Road being bypassed, truncated, or abandoned. Newer alignments with better gradients and stronger retaining walls were constructed nearby. In practice, that meant that some segments stopped seeing regular traffic long before they were formally closed. When collapses finally made them unusable, repairs often did not come; authorities focused on the newer, “official” highway instead.

The result is a patchwork of ghost infrastructure. You can still find bits of the old road – stone parapets, hairpin bends carved into rock, fragments of culverts – cut off from the modern network. No replacement road was ever built along those exact lines because engineers decided to re‑imagine the route completely rather than duplicate a flawed corridor. For hikers and history‑minded travelers, these abandoned stretches are fascinating. For locals who once walked, carted, or drove along them daily, they are a reminder that even mountain roads can be disposable.

Everyone knows the Channel Tunnel changed travel between Britain and continental Europe. What gets less attention is the specific network of short, high‑frequency roll‑on roll‑off ferry crossings that shrank or disappeared as a result, especially for certain ports whose traffic depended on direct car and truck flows. Before the tunnel opened in the mid‑1990s, routes like Folkestone–Boulogne or Newhaven–Dieppe had a very different strategic weight. They were not just alternatives; for many hauliers and drivers, they were the default.

As trade patterns consolidated around the quickest links between major motorways, some of these ferry lines were progressively scaled back. A few closed altogether. While the English Channel still sees plenty of ferries, the precise combination of ports, sailing frequencies, and pricing that shaped overland European logistics in the 1970s and 1980s is gone. The tunnel fundamentally rewrote the map, pulling flows toward its own terminals and away from smaller harbors that could not match the tunnel’s speed or reliability.

In theory, ships could always be reintroduced, and occasionally there are attempts to revive or rebrand old routes. But the original patterns – night crossings with dedicated truck decks, particular routines of customs and rest stops – are effectively extinct. No new maritime route has emerged that plays quite the same role for the affected smaller ports. Before the First World War shattered empires and redrew borders, urban tram systems in parts of Central Europe often crossed frontiers so casually that passengers barely noticed. You could ride a tram from what is now one country straight into another without a dramatic station change; the line might simply keep going across a bridge or through a shared factory district. After the war, and especially after the Second World War, these cross‑border routes became politically awkward, economically fragile, or both.

Some were cut at the new borders and never restored. Bus lines or mainline rail services might have been introduced nearby, but the idea of a simple, local, electric tram trundling from one nation into another mostly disappeared outside a handful of special cases. In the Cold War climate, authorities were understandably nervous about easy, unpoliced movements across the Iron Curtain, and trams were far too accessible and hard to control compared with international trains with passport checks.

By the time borders softened and then opened again in the late twentieth and early twenty‑first centuries, urban planners had often reshaped networks inward, away from old border gates. Restoring a tram across the frontier would mean renegotiating land use, rebuilding track, and aligning timetables and standards across two or more national bureaucracies. In many cities, it was just easier to leave those ghostly alignments as historical footnotes. The replaced modes – usually buses or private cars – do the job in a blunt way, but the underlying routes, right down the old streets, were never truly reborn.

For centuries, trans‑Saharan caravan routes carried salt, gold, textiles, and enslaved people between North and West Africa. These were not “roads” in a modern engineering sense, but stable corridors of movement, with established oases, resting points, and rhythms. A caravan master knew the line between Timbuktu and the Maghreb as intimately as a ship’s captain knows a coastal passage. The exact tracks might shift with weather and security conditions, but the routes themselves, as social institutions, were astonishingly resilient.

The rise of coastal shipping, colonial railways, and eventually paved highways gradually eroded the economic logic of long desert caravans. Motorized trucks can carry more, faster, and with less dependence on fragile oases and camel fodder. As states asserted control over desert spaces and borders, many traditional paths became either too risky or too regulated to sustain their old traffic. What remained was often a lattice of informal, sometimes illicit, smuggling paths rather than the formal trade arteries that once underpinned entire cities.

Modern roads do exist in parts of the Sahara, but they typically follow alignments chosen for engineering or political convenience, not as one‑to‑one replacements for the historical caravan axes. That means some once‑famous lines have no modern counterpart at all; their associated waystations faded or were abandoned. When people romanticize the old caravans, they often do not realize that several of those exact cross‑desert “routes” are effectively dead. Satellite images sometimes still show faint tracks and ruined caravanserais, but in human terms, the path is gone.

The name “Orient Express” has taken on a life of its own, tied up with novels, films, and luxury tourism. What is easy to miss is that the legendary train’s original route – linking Paris to Constantinople (now Istanbul) via a specific chain of cities and frontier crossings – has not operated in its historic form for a long time. Wars, new borders, changing timetables, and evolving railway priorities chipped away at the original alignment until the brand survived more as a marketing echo than a literal, continuous route.

Later trains bearing the Orient Express name took different paths, skipped cities, or ended short of Istanbul. Eventually, the scheduled service itself ceased, leaving only heritage runs and private luxury trains that evoke the vibe without replicating the old operating pattern. Freight and passenger trains still crisscross the region, of course, and you can absolutely travel from Paris to Istanbul by rail with enough changes. But the specific, single‑train route that once defined the Orient Express experience is gone.

No new direct train has stepped in to occupy that exact corridor with similar prestige and continuity. The modern European rail network is more hub‑and‑spoke than grand‑arc. High‑speed lines bend toward national capitals and big business corridors, not romantic, multi‑day odysseys. In that sense, the Orient Express is a perfect example of a route whose myth persists long after the actual, physical line of service quietly fell out of use and stayed that way.

In the early twentieth century, North America was laced with interurban electric railways: light‑rail style lines radiating from cities into surrounding towns and countryside. Places like southern Ontario, the American Midwest, and parts of California had dense webs of these so‑called “radials,” often running down the middle of roads or on private rights‑of‑way just outside them. They were cheap to ride, relatively frequent, and absolutely central to how people commuted, went shopping, or visited relatives beyond walking distance.

The rise of private automobiles, improved roads, and a deeply cultural turn toward car‑oriented lifestyles gutted the interurban business model. Through the 1920s, 1930s, and into the postwar years, lines were abandoned or converted into bus routes that rarely matched the original service frequency or comfort. In a telling detail, many of these corridors were later repurposed for highways or simply built over, cementing their disappearance in the physical landscape as well as in the timetable.

Today’s light‑rail revivals in cities like Los Angeles, Seattle, or Toronto sometimes follow broadly similar directions to one or two of the old radials, but they almost never reoccupy the entire original alignments. Key segments were lost to development or freeways. So while we talk about “bringing back streetcars” or “re‑creating regional rail,” the fact remains: many interurban routes that once existed end to end have no exact replacement. You can drive along roughly the same path, sure, but the point‑to‑point, rail‑based experience that once made those routes feel inevitable is gone.

Few roads carry as much symbolic weight as U.S. Route 66, the “Main Street of America.” What many people miss is that “Route 66” was not just one concrete line, but a series of alignments that shifted over the decades. Some of the earliest stretches wound directly through small downtowns, over narrow bridges, and along primitive pavements that later engineers judged too slow or unsafe. When the Interstate Highway System arrived, great swaths of original 66 were bypassed, then decommissioned altogether.

In some regions, Interstate 40 or other freeways roughly shadow the old road, but that is not the same thing as replacing it. Segments were left isolated, cut off by new grade‑separated interchanges that made it awkward to even find the old route, let alone use it as a continuous cross‑country corridor. Towns that had once lived off steady streams of passing motorists suddenly found themselves at the end of a quiet, truncated local road. The through‑route had moved, and nothing filled the old channel.

I once drove a surviving fragment of old 66 in New Mexico and was struck by how final the abandonment felt. You could see the ghost of the old logic: diners at logical lunch stops, motels at plausible day‑length intervals, gas stations placed just where older cars would need them. All of that made sense only when the road was a living artery. Once the interstate took over, that choreography shattered. No new signed federal route stitched those ghost towns back into a single, coherent path; they remain beads on a string whose middle has snapped.
